  • What if I am claustrophobic?

    People with claustrophobia consistently report no problem with floating. You have complete control of your experience. You may choose to leave your lid open, or even leave it cracked open if desired.

  • Can I drown if I fall asleep?

    Some people do fall asleep, but the water is buoyant, so you stay afloat.

  • How are the pods kept clean?

    Salt is a natural anti-microbial and antiseptic, especially at the high concentration present in the float pods. Every guest showers in house before starting a float session. The water is filtered between each client, where it is also disinfected by UV lighting and ozone. Between each client, a dose of 35% hydrogen peroxide is added to the water.
